Centerville body armor maker featured in White House event

Body armor plates manufactured in Centerville, Iowa, were exhibited in Monday’s “Made in America” event at the White House. RMA Armament CEO Blake Waldrop is featured in a video on the company’s website. “I started this business to help better protect the end user, my fellow Marines, my fellow police officers,” Waldrop says in the video. “Mr. Robot” star Rami Malek confirmed to star in Freddie Mercury biopic, “X-Men” director Bryan Singer to helm

Getty Images/Antonio de Moraes Barros Filho(LOS ANGELES) -- Queen has confirmed that Mr. Robot star Rami Malek has been cast in the lead role of the long-in-the-works Freddie Mercury biopic Bohemian Rhapsody, and that Bryan Singer, director and writer of most of the X-Men films, will be directing the film. Jodie Whittaker becomes the first female Dr. Who in the series’ 54 years

Getty Images/Mike Marsland(LONDON) -- Jodie Whittaker is the new Dr. Who, making her the 13th actor and first woman to play the doctor since the iconic U.K. series began in 1963, BBC America announced Sunday. The 35-year-old British actress will replace Peter Capaldi when the series returns for its annual Christmas special.
